Subwoofer speakers are used to create the low end of the full audio spectrum. A computer subwoofer gives the computer user the full sound experience for watching movies, listening to music or playing video games. With a good quality set of computer subwoofers attached to your personal computer, you will get theater-quality sound and bass for all of your downloads and activities.

The discerning and careful shopper would also keep in mind the room’s size where the computer is placed, and buy a system accordingly. For instance, the Altec Lansing BXR1221 speaker system will probably be all right if you are watching a movie in a small room such as a dorm room or small bedroom. But, in a large room like a living room or home theater you might want to go with something like the Logitech Z2300 with a 12″ subwoofer instead.
You should also take into account whether or not you have an amplifier before you go shopping. A passive system will only have a speaker, but an active system is self-powered and will have its own amplifier.
